I used to have a pimped out YZ250 two stroke for Glamis, bumped up to 285 or so. Light, fast, with great suspension...I swore I'd never go four stroke....well....after getting spanked by all the guys on four strokes I made the jump....had a WR426..before this but it was heavier than my 250 and I could really feel the difference in the sand....Then I got this bike.....felt just as light as my two smoke but with a ton more low end power.....no more winding it out all day....stick it in 3rd and easy cruising....I loved having that low end power for those little bumps or drops where you needed to get the front wheel in the air.....just blip the throttle and the four stroke would carry the front end all day. Even thow I didn't get a ton of time on this bike....I think it was the easiest bike I've ever ridden.
